Tulip Season in the Gold Coast
Right before we left Chicago, the Gold Coast did what it always does best in spring-explode with tulips. Whole blocks lined with red, orange, and yellow blooms, just casually showing off in front of those historic brownstones and limestone facades.
It's one of my favorite little city traditions. Every April, the neighborhood feels like it wakes up from hibernation. Even on gray days, the flowers glow. It's the kind of thing you start looking forward to without even realizing it-like the city's way of saying, "hey, winter's over... you made it."
